Build a sukkah that families can drive their car through, greet rabbi and cantor, shake lulav, get a gift bag. Allowed us to have a program where congregation families could actually attend physically rather than the normal COVID mode of telecommunications.
We wanted a way to celebrate Sukkot at the synagogue. Since we could not gather in person in a large group because of the COVID pandemic (even outside) we chose a way to allow families to come to the synagogue to celebrate Sukkot without getting out of their cars. We took the Men's Club sukkah and modified it so that cars could drive through it - even SUVs. Our rabbi and other synagogue leaders greeted the family in each car as it drove into the sukkah. The occupants were then led through some prayers, including shaking the lulav. They proceeded through the sukkah and were greeted at the exit by the cantor and were given a gift bag. We also used this opportunity to give congregants the opportunity to conduct some synagogue business that had to be in-person - like dropping off the High Holy Day machzorim that they had borrowed for the High Holy Days.
